The Petz Violin Bow 1095VN 4/4 is a workshop-grade bow crafted from pernambuco wood, the traditional material used in professional bow making. Sized for full-size (4/4) violins, this octagonal stick delivers the balanced feel and responsive articulation that advancing students and serious players look for. An ebony frog with Parisian eye, nickel silver-plated fittings, and a three-part screw round out the build. Made in Austria by PetzVienna, it weighs 61 g and pairs naturally with horsehair for clean, even tone production.

What to look for in a 4/4 violin bow
Pernambuco is the benchmark wood for bows in this tier, combining stiffness with the flexibility needed for clean string crossings. A defined grip feel comes from the octagonal cross-section, while the ebony frog and silver-plated nickel fittings resist daily wear. A three-part screw lets the player fine-tune hair tension for different repertoire.
